Abstract

The utility model relates to the technical field of pharmaceutical equipment, in particular to a cleaning device of a rotary tablet press, which comprises a base and further comprises: the rotary bottom basin is arranged on one side of the upper surface of the base and is rotationally connected with the upper surface of the base, and the middle part of the upper surface of the rotary bottom basin is rotationally connected with a rotary pressure plate; the pressing holes are formed and penetrate through the upper surface of the rotary bottom basin and the upper surface of the rotary pressing plate; the lower end of the cleaning mechanism is fixedly connected with one side of the upper surface of the base; according to the utility model, through the cleaning mechanism, after the rotary bottom basin and the rotary pressure plate finish tabletting, the rotary bottom basin and the rotary pressure plate are cleaned in time, so that the residual medicine powder is clear for the first time, the powder residue is prevented from adhering to the rotary bottom basin and the rotary pressure plate, the later tabletting is influenced, and the tablet is effectively prevented from being polluted by the residual powder during tabletting.

Background
The tablet press is a relatively common pharmaceutical device for preparing medicinal powder into tablets, is mainly used for researching tablet process in pharmaceutical industry, presses particles into round, special-shaped and automatic continuous production equipment with characters, symbols and graphic tablets with diameters not larger than 13mm, has wider application range along with development of market demands, is not only limited to pressing Chinese and western medicine tablets, but also can widely press health-care foods, veterinary medicine tablets, chemical tablets and the like, but the conventional rotary tablet press has the problems that the normal use of the rotary tablet press is affected due to the fact that the material powder is scattered onto a rotary pressure plate due to the action of centrifugal force in the rotation process, and meanwhile, other powder is mixed with the tablets coming out of the rotary tablet press, so that the pressure plate and the like are required to be disassembled and cleaned after each time of tabletting, and the labor intensity of workers is increased; therefore, the existing requirements are not met, and a rotary tablet press cleaning device is provided.

Referring to fig. 1-3, the present utility model provides a technical solution:
the utility model provides a rotary tablet press cleaning device, includes base 1, still includes:
the rotary bottom basin 2 is arranged on one side of the upper surface of the base 1 and is rotationally connected with the upper surface of the base 1, and a rotary pressure plate 3 is rotationally connected in the middle of the upper surface of the rotary bottom basin 2;
the tablet pressing holes 4 are formed in a plurality of ways and penetrate through the upper surface of the rotary bottom basin 2 and the upper surface of the rotary pressing plate 3;
the lower end of the cleaning mechanism 5 is fixedly connected with one side of the upper surface of the base 1;
the controller 12 is fixedly connected with one side of the upper surface of the cleaning shell 8, and the controller 12 is fixedly connected with the rotating motor 13, the air heater 14 and the cleaner 19 respectively;
through the clearance mechanism 5 that sets up, accomplish the preforming work back at rotatory end basin 2 and rotatory pressure disk 3, carry out cleaning operation to in time rotatory end basin 2 and rotatory pressure disk 3, with remaining medicine powder very first time clear, thereby prevent that the powder from remaining the preforming after the adhesion influences on rotatory end basin 2 and rotatory pressure disk 3, effectually avoided the tablet by remaining powder pollution when the preforming.
As an example of the present utility model, the cleaning mechanism 5 includes:
the cleaning shell 8, the lower end of the cleaning shell 8 is fixedly connected with the upper surface of the base 1, and a slot 9 is formed in one side of the cleaning shell 8;
the brush mechanism 10 is arranged on one side in the slot 9 and is rotationally connected with the slot 9;
the motor box 11, the motor box 11 is fixedly connected with one side of the upper end of the cleaning shell 8;
the brush arrangement 10 comprises:
the rotary rod 16 is arranged on one side in the slot 9, the lower end of the rotary rod 16 is rotationally connected with the inner lower surface of the slot 9, and the upper end of the rotary rod 16 penetrates through the upper side in the slot 9 and is fixedly connected with the output end of the rotary motor 13;
a rotating motor 13, the rotating motor 13 being fixedly connected with the inside of the motor box 11;
one end of the cleaning brush 17 is fixedly connected with one side of the middle part of the rotary rod 16, and the upper side and the lower side of the cleaning brush 17 are fixedly connected with brush heads 18;
after the tabletting operation of the rotary bottom basin 2 and the rotary pressure plate 3 is finished, the rotary motor 13 is started to drive the rotary rod 16 to rotate, the cleaning brush 17 is rotated to be kept in a vertical state with the cleaning shell 8, at the moment, the brush head 18 is positioned between the rotary bottom basin 2 and the rotary pressure plate 3, the rotary bottom basin 2 and the rotary pressure plate 3 continuously keep in a rotary state, powder on the surfaces of the rotary bottom basin 2 and the rotary pressure plate 3 including the tablet pressing holes 4 starts to sweep off through the brush head 18, the powder can be quickly swept off through the arranged brush head 18, meanwhile, the dust in the tablet pressing holes 4 can be swept out, the defect that manual cleaning is needed is effectively overcome, meanwhile, the sweeping-off dust of the brush head 18 can be effectively guaranteed through the rotary acting force of the rotary bottom basin 2 and the rotary pressure plate 3, the cleaning efficiency is improved, and meanwhile, the cleaning effect is improved.
As an example of the utility model, a cleaner 19, the cleaner 19 is fixedly connected with the middle part of one side of a cleaning brush 17, and a plurality of spray heads 20 are symmetrically arranged at the upper end and the lower end of the cleaner 19;
the water pipe 21, the water pipe 21 is fixedly connected with one side of the cleaner 19, and the other end of the water pipe 21 penetrates one side of the cleaning shell 8 and is fixedly connected with an external water pipe;
the water collecting tank 6 is arranged on the upper surface of the base 1, and the water collecting tank 6 is arranged right below the rotary bottom basin 2 and has an outer diameter larger than that of the rotary bottom basin 2;
the water outlet groove 7 is formed in one side of the upper surface of the base 1, one end of the water outlet groove 7 is connected with the water collecting groove 6, and the other end of the water outlet groove 7 penetrates through one side of the upper surface of the base 1;
the air heater 14, the air heater 14 is fixedly connected with one side in the slot 9, the upper and lower ends of the front surface of the air heater 14 are provided with air outlets 15, and the output ends of the air outlets 15 face the rotary bottom basin 2 and the rotary pressure plate 3;
after the brush head 18 starts cleaning, the cleaner 19 starts to spray cleaning water to the surfaces of the rotary bottom basin 2 and the rotary platen 3 through the spray head 20, deep cleaning is started to be performed on the surfaces of the rotary bottom basin 2 and the rotary platen 3, the surfaces of the rotary bottom basin 2 and the rotary platen 3 are cleaned through the depth of sprayed cleaning liquid, then the cleaning liquid is collected through the water collecting tank 6 and flows into an external collecting container through the water outlet tank 7, the liquid is prevented from overflowing and flowing over the upper surface of the base 1, finally the cleaner 19 is closed, the air heater 14 is started, hot air is blown out from the air outlet 15, rapid drying is started to be performed on the rotary bottom basin 2 and the rotary platen 3, the cleaning effect of the cleaning mechanism 5 on the rotary bottom basin 2 and the rotary platen 3 is effectively improved through the arranged air heater 14 and the like, rapid drying is ensured after the cleaning is finished, the rotary bottom basin 2 and the rotary platen 3 can be used in a fastest manner, the cleaning effect is ensured, and the working efficiency of the tablet press is improved.
Working principle: after the tabletting operation of the rotary bottom basin 2 and the rotary platen 3 is finished, the rotary motor 13 is started to drive the rotary rod 16 to rotate, the cleaning brush 17 is rotated to be kept in a vertical state with the cleaning shell 8, at the moment, the brush head 18 is positioned between the rotary bottom basin 2 and the rotary platen 3, the rotary bottom basin 2 and the rotary platen 3 are kept in a continuous rotating state, powder on the surfaces of the rotary bottom basin 2 and the rotary platen 3 including the lamination holes 4 starts to sweep through the brush head 18, after the brush head 18 starts cleaning, the cleaner 19 is started, spraying cleaning water on the surfaces of the rotary bottom basin 2 and the rotary platen 3 is started through the spray head 20, deep cleaning is started on the surfaces of the rotary bottom basin 2 and the rotary platen 3, cleaning liquid is collected through the water collecting tank 6 and flows into an external collecting container through the water outlet tank 7, the liquid is prevented from overflowing on the upper surface of the base 1, the cleaner 19 is closed finally, the hot air blower 14 is started, rapid drying is started from the air outlet 15, and the surfaces of the rotary bottom basin 2 and the rotary platen 3 are started to be subjected to rapid drying operation for next time.
